Well let's see here. For starters you skipped episodes 6 and 7 so you didn't even see the lead up to 8. That's not going to make you appreciate the episode right there. I can understand hating ep 4 because the guest animator was terrible but I just can't see how you can't like the other episodes.

For starters the animation quality is top notch. it uses a very adaptable style that can be used in serious situations and in joke situations, much like Fooly Cooly.

But what's great about TTGL is that it's one of the best coming-of-age stories I can even begin to speak of. it's a show where the main character starts out weak and ignorant but through his trials and tribulations becomes an adult and finds his place in the world. of course, you wouldn't no that since you never even gave it a chance for all of the character development to flesh out. There's also a time skip after episode 16 so you really haven't even begun to scratch the surface of the story and the plight that humanity must face.

In addition to being a coming of age story TTGL has the central theme that you can always succeed if you put forth the effort. This can range from simple things such as surviving day to day or destroying an evil regime to save the human race. Such a theme is paramount to the story and is presented in a wholly interesting fashion.

Going back to the animation we have the character and mech designs themselves which are for the most part inventive and all have a uniqueness to them. Whether it's the brash and manly Kamina, the scared and silent Simon (though he doesn't stay that way) or the charming and innocent Nia they are all represented in a style that reflects their own personality. The mechs almost seem like cariacatures themselves but the style works for them and allows them to be distinct from other mech shows such as Evangelion, Code Geass and the Gundam franchise.

I have no idea where you draw these similarities to Pokemon and Inuyasha. Sure the beginning of the story has a light-hearted feel but that's because everything is supposed to seem innocent. the characters need to grow up and face the harsh realities of the world. You're trying to say it'll be predictable as well? I highly doubt you can predict what will happen to humanity after the timeskip or even what the main villain's intentions are. Legitimately give this series a chance and experience it as a whole before trying to say that it's terrible.
